# Pondworks API — DB pool config, prod.
# POOL_MIN=5, POOL_MAX=40. If you see saturation alerts, bump POOL_MAX
# to 60 max; beyond that the primary chokes. Idle timeout is 30s on
# purpose — do not raise. Restart the service after any change here.
# The database connection secret is set on the next line.

vault entry, yahif-yajep: COURIER_KEY29=b802bdf8034096b65a51c6ba5abe2

## Changelog — v4.2.0

Renamed `PARTITION_INTERVAL` to `PARTITION_BY_MONTH` across the Ledgerline warehouse config. The old name is honored until v5.0 with a deprecation warning at startup. Monthly partitions are now created two months ahead instead of one, reducing cutover risk. Note that the partition-manager still authenticates to the catalog service via a token defined on this env-file line:

sealed setting: VAULT_KEY13=741e0a90de233

### Occupancy Feed Auth

The Garagio occupancy feed polls our internal Stallcount service every thirty seconds, so don't hammer it harder than that. Auth is a single header, nothing fancy — no OAuth dance, no refresh tokens. If you get 403s, the key probably rotated and nobody told you. The current key is below.

gateway credential: kto3_qfe

### CI: Stormrelay Fan-Out Flakes

On-call: Stormrelay fan-out tests fail intermittently when the mock alert broker restarts mid-run. Symptom: dropped deliveries in the last shard only. Fix: rerun with broker warm-up enabled; one retry usually clears it. If two retries fail, the broker image is stale — pull the latest and rebuild. Do not silence the test; dropped alerts in prod are a paging event. Attach the failing run's trace token, shown below.

session token of tajef-bageg = htk21_5d90d574934f3ccae6437